Ruby- throated Hummingbird

Caught this ruby-throated hummingbird visiting my feeder today and the flowers in the garden. The hummingbird's rapid wing motion produces a distinct hum.... hence the bird's name.....which rises and falls according to the wing speed. At great accelerations the hum sometimes turns into a continuous high note, similar to that produced by arrows or bullets in flight. Always a delight to watch!
